For the eighth year in a row, Central Tech has been awarded a Top Workplaces honor by Oklahoman Top Workplaces. The list is based solely on employee feedback gathered through a third-party survey administered by employee engagement technology partner Energage LLC. The confidential survey uniquely measures 15 culture drivers that are critical to the success of any organization: including alignment, execution, and connection, just to name a few.  

“Earning a Top Workplaces award is a badge of honor for companies, especially because it comes authentically from their employees,” said Eric Rubino, Energage CEO. “That’s something to be proud of. In today’s market, leaders must ensure they’re allowing employees to have a voice and be heard. That’s paramount. Top Workplaces do this, and it pays dividends.” 

“Employee feedback is what wins Top Workplace awards. We are thrilled our employees use their voice to come together, discuss opportunities, and help shape the future of Central Tech.”Kent Burris, superintendent of Central Tech

It’s no surprise the Central Tech vision is everyone achieves success. The inviting environment creates an inclusive culture that can be seen by all. Even visitors comment on how comfortable they feel at Central Tech. This sense of togetherness creates a positive impact on students, clients, and staff.  

“Much more than a tagline, we fulfill Central Tech’s mission of – changing lives with technical education and services. We aim to support our students and employees’ total well-being by creating an environment that allows our people to grow both professionally and personally,” said Burris.
